The Government of Montenegro strongly condemns attack on the Embassy of the United States of America (USA) in Podgorica, the safety and security of the embassy staff was not violated, the Government announced.
"The Government of Montenegro strongly condemns last night's incident in which one person was killed by activating explosive devices near the Embassy of the United States of America (USA) in Podgorica. The Minister of Internal Affairs Mevludin Nuhodžić and the director of the Police Administration Slavko Stojanović visited the site before noon today and visited the Embassy U.S. On that occasion, as well as in other contacts of Montenegrin officials with representatives of the U.S., regret regarding the attack and solidarity with the U.S. was expressed, and our firm position was emphasized that this event will not and cannot worsen the high level of security and safety of diplomatic missions and the overall security situation in Montenegro," the Government announcement states.
The announcement adds that the competent authorities are making every effort to shed light on this case.
